ABSTRACT
As an emerging environmental pollutant, microplastics have attracted more and more attention for its influence on the ecological environment and human health. Due to its wide range of usage and production, difficult degradation and other characteristics, as well as the continuous and substantial increase in the use of plastic products, the number of plastic fragments in the environment continues to increase, which leads to the accumulation of microplastics in the environment and organisms, spread through the food chain, and ultimately poses a threat to human health. At the same time, in the plastic production, synthetic textile, and other industries, the incidence of workers related occupational diseases greatly increased. In this paper, the concept, classification, source, impact on biological and human health of microplastics are summarized, and propose solutions on the current situation of microplastics pollution in China, we hope this review could provide effective reference for further carry out risk assessment of microplastics pollution on human health and formulate legislation to control microplastics pollution.
